feat(ui): add prefill and thinking controls to Caption tab

Add minimal UI controls to expose new VQA functionality:
- Prefill Text input for guiding VLM responses
- Thinking Mode checkbox for reasoning models
- Keep Thinking Trace checkbox for output retention
- Keep Prefill checkbox for output retention
- Annotated Image output panel for detection visualization
- Updated button handlers to pass new parameters

def vlm_caption_wrapper(question, system_prompt, prompt, image, model_name, prefill, thinking_mode):
"""Wrapper to handle tuple returns from vqa.interrogate with annotated images."""
from modules.interrogate import vqa
result = vqa.interrogate(question, system_prompt, prompt, image, model_name, prefill, thinking_mode)
if isinstance(result, tuple):
text, annotated_image = result
if annotated_image is not None:
return text, gr.update(value=annotated_image, visible=True)
return text, gr.update(visible=False)
return result, gr.update(visible=False)
